Skip to content

Commit 1f90644

Browse files
committed
chore: remove redundant animation class
1 parent 4277b19 commit 1f90644

8 files changed

Lines changed: 16 additions & 43 deletions

File tree

app/components/CollapsibleSection.vue

Lines changed: 1 addition &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-92,11 +92,7 @@ useHead({
9292
:aria-label="ariaLabel"
9393
@click="toggle"
9494
>
95-
<span
96-
v-if="isLoading"
97-
class="i-svg-spinners:ring-resize w-3 h-3 motion-safe:animate-spin"
98-
aria-hidden="true"
99-
/>
95+
<span v-if="isLoading" class="i-svg-spinners:ring-resize w-3 h-3" aria-hidden="true" />
10096
<span
10197
v-else
10298
class="w-3 h-3 transition-transform duration-200"

app/components/Compare/FacetCard.vue

Lines changed: 1 addition &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-111,10 +111,7 @@ function getShortName(header: string): string {
111111
<span class="relative min-w-0 text-end">
112112
<!-- Loading state -->
113113
<template v-if="isCellLoading(index)">
114-
<span
115-
class="i-svg-spinners:ring-resize w-4 h-4 text-fg-subtle motion-safe:animate-spin"
116-
aria-hidden="true"
117-
/>
114+
<span class="i-svg-spinners:ring-resize w-4 h-4 text-fg-subtle" aria-hidden="true" />
118115
</template>
119116

120117
<!-- No data -->

app/components/Compare/FacetRow.vue

Lines changed: 1 addition &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-114,10 +114,7 @@ function isCellLoading(index: number): boolean {
114114

115115
<!-- Loading state -->
116116
<template v-if="isCellLoading(index)">
117-
<span
118-
class="i-svg-spinners:ring-resize w-4 h-4 text-fg-subtle motion-safe:animate-spin"
119-
aria-hidden="true"
120-
/>
117+
<span class="i-svg-spinners:ring-resize w-4 h-4 text-fg-subtle" aria-hidden="true" />
121118
</template>
122119

123120
<!-- No data -->

app/components/Org/TeamsPanel.vue

Lines changed: 2 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-328,10 +328,7 @@ watch(lastExecutionTime, () => {
328328

329329
<!-- Loading state -->
330330
<div v-if="isLoadingTeams && teams.length === 0" class="p-8 text-center">
331-
<span
332-
class="i-svg-spinners:ring-resize w-5 h-5 text-fg-muted motion-safe:animate-spin mx-auto"
333-
aria-hidden="true"
334-
/>
331+
<span class="i-svg-spinners:ring-resize w-5 h-5 text-fg-muted mx-auto" aria-hidden="true" />
335332
<p class="font-mono text-sm text-fg-muted mt-2">{{ $t('org.teams.loading') }}</p>
336333
</div>
337334

@@ -388,7 +385,7 @@ watch(lastExecutionTime, () => {
388385
</span>
389386
<span
390387
v-if="isLoadingUsers[teamName]"
391-
class="i-svg-spinners:ring-resize w-3 h-3 text-fg-muted motion-safe:animate-spin"
388+
class="i-svg-spinners:ring-resize w-3 h-3 text-fg-muted"
392389
aria-hidden="true"
393390
/>
394391
</button>

app/components/Package/MetricsBadges.vue

Lines changed: 3 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-73,7 +73,7 @@ const typesHref = computed(() => {
7373
:tabindex="0"
7474
:classicon="
7575
isLoading
76-
? 'i-svg-spinners:ring-resize motion-safe:animate-spin'
76+
? 'i-svg-spinners:ring-resize '
7777
: hasTypes
7878
? 'i-lucide:check'
7979
: 'i-lucide:circle-x'
@@ -95,7 +95,7 @@ const typesHref = computed(() => {
9595
:variant="hasEsm && !isLoading ? 'default' : 'ghost'"
9696
:classicon="
9797
isLoading
98-
? 'i-svg-spinners:ring-resize motion-safe:animate-spin'
98+
? 'i-svg-spinners:ring-resize '
9999
: hasEsm
100100
? 'i-lucide:check'
101101
: 'i-lucide:circle-x'
@@ -112,9 +112,7 @@ const typesHref = computed(() => {
112112
<TagStatic
113113
tabindex="0"
114114
:variant="isLoading ? 'ghost' : 'default'"
115-
:classicon="
116-
isLoading ? 'i-svg-spinners:ring-resize motion-safe:animate-spin' : 'i-lucide:check'
117-
"
115+
:classicon="isLoading ? 'i-svg-spinners:ring-resize ' : 'i-lucide:check'"
118116
>
119117
CJS
120118
</TagStatic>

app/components/Package/Versions.vue

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-440,7 +440,7 @@ function majorGroupContainsCurrent(group: (typeof otherMajorGroups.value)[0]): b
440440
>
441441
<span
442442
v-if="loadingTags.has(row.tag)"
443-
class="i-svg-spinners:ring-resize w-3 h-3 motion-safe:animate-spin"
443+
class="i-svg-spinners:ring-resize w-3 h-3"
444444
data-testid="loading-spinner"
445445
aria-hidden="true"
446446
/>
@@ -595,7 +595,7 @@ function majorGroupContainsCurrent(group: (typeof otherMajorGroups.value)[0]): b
595595
>
596596
<span
597597
v-if="otherVersionsLoading"
598-
class="i-svg-spinners:ring-resize w-3 h-3 motion-safe:animate-spin"
598+
class="i-svg-spinners:ring-resize w-3 h-3"
599599
data-testid="loading-spinner"
600600
aria-hidden="true"
601601
/>

app/components/VersionSelector.vue

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-540,7 +540,7 @@ watch(
540540
>
541541
<span
542542
v-if="group.isLoading"
543-
class="i-svg-spinners:ring-resize w-3 h-3 motion-safe:animate-spin"
543+
class="i-svg-spinners:ring-resize w-3 h-3"
544544
aria-hidden="true"
545545
/>
546546
<span

app/pages/package/[[org]]/[name].vue

Lines changed: 5 additions & 17 deletions
Original file line numberDiff line numberDiff line change
@@ -824,7 +824,7 @@ const showSkeleton = shallowRef(false)
824824
>
825825
<span
826826
v-if="isLoadingLikeData"
827-
class="i-svg-spinners:ring-resize w-3 h-3 motion-safe:animate-spin my-0.5"
827+
class="i-svg-spinners:ring-resize w-3 h-3 my-0.5"
828828
aria-hidden="true"
829829
/>
830830
<span v-else>
@@ -962,10 +962,7 @@ const showSkeleton = shallowRef(false)
962962
"
963963
class="inline-flex items-center gap-1 text-fg-subtle"
964964
>
965-
<span
966-
class="i-svg-spinners:ring-resize w-3 h-3 motion-safe:animate-spin"
967-
aria-hidden="true"
968-
/>
965+
<span class="i-svg-spinners:ring-resize w-3 h-3" aria-hidden="true" />
969966
</span>
970967
<span v-else-if="totalDepsCount !== null">{{
971968
numberFormatter.format(totalDepsCount)
@@ -1030,10 +1027,7 @@ const showSkeleton = shallowRef(false)
10301027
v-if="installSizeStatus === 'pending'"
10311028
class="inline-flex items-center gap-1 text-fg-subtle"
10321029
>
1033-
<span
1034-
class="i-svg-spinners:ring-resize w-3 h-3 motion-safe:animate-spin"
1035-
aria-hidden="true"
1036-
/>
1030+
<span class="i-svg-spinners:ring-resize w-3 h-3" aria-hidden="true" />
10371031
</span>
10381032
<span v-else-if="installSize?.totalSize" dir="ltr">
10391033
{{ bytesFormatter.format(installSize.totalSize) }}
@@ -1053,10 +1047,7 @@ const showSkeleton = shallowRef(false)
10531047
v-if="vulnTreeStatus === 'pending' || vulnTreeStatus === 'idle'"
10541048
class="inline-flex items-center gap-1 text-fg-subtle"
10551049
>
1056-
<span
1057-
class="i-svg-spinners:ring-resize w-3 h-3 motion-safe:animate-spin"
1058-
aria-hidden="true"
1059-
/>
1050+
<span class="i-svg-spinners:ring-resize w-3 h-3" aria-hidden="true" />
10601051
</span>
10611052
<span v-else-if="vulnTreeStatus === 'success'">
10621053
<span v-if="hasVulnerabilities" class="text-amber-700 dark:text-amber-500">
@@ -1320,10 +1311,7 @@ const showSkeleton = shallowRef(false)
13201311
v-if="provenanceStatus === 'pending'"
13211312
class="mt-8 flex items-center gap-2 text-fg-subtle text-sm"
13221313
>
1323-
<span
1324-
class="i-svg-spinners:ring-resize w-4 h-4 motion-safe:animate-spin"
1325-
aria-hidden="true"
1326-
/>
1314+
<span class="i-svg-spinners:ring-resize w-4 h-4" aria-hidden="true" />
13271315
<span>{{ $t('package.provenance_section.title') }}…</span>
13281316
</div>
13291317
<PackageProvenanceSection

0 commit comments

Comments
 (0)